The Background of Online Gambling in Australia
The Australian online gambling market has witnessed significant changes over recent years. Legislative shifts have allowed for an influx of international operators while maintaining strict adherence to responsible gambling practices. With millions participating in various forms of betting—from sports wagering to live casino games—the need for platforms that understand local habits is paramount.
The government regulates online gambling through a mix of federal and state laws, primarily falling under the Interactive Gambling Act 2001. Each state has its own regulations regarding online betting operations, making it crucial for any platform to comply with these laws to operate legally and ethically.
